## 1. Mitigating Stormwater Runoff and Flooding
St. Petersburg is prone to heavy rainfall during the summer months (June-September), which can lead to stormwater runoff and flooding issues. A professional landscape design can help mitigate these problems by incorporating rain gardens, bioswales, or permeable pavers. These features allow excess water to infiltrate the ground, reducing stormwater runoff and alleviating pressure on local drainage systems.
### How Rain Gardens Can Help
Rain gardens are shallow depressions that collect and filter stormwater runoff. They're an excellent solution for St. Petersburg homeowners who want to reduce their environmental impact while maintaining a beautiful landscape. By incorporating native plants, mulch, and other design elements, rain gardens can become stunning focal points in your outdoor space.

## 3. Designing for Sandy Soil
St. Petersburg's soil composition is primarily sandy, which can be challenging to work with when designing a landscape. A professional landscape designer will select plants that thrive in these conditions and incorporate amendments like compost or mulch to improve soil health.
### Tips for Working with Sandy Soil
When working with sandy soil, keep the following tips in mind:
* Use organic matter like compost or well-rotted manure to improve soil structure. * Incorporate water-holding polymers to reduce moisture loss and retain nutrients. * Select plants with deep roots that can access moisture deeper in the soil profile.
